It's great that you enjoy growing Lobelia inflata and find it useful for keeping tomato worms away from your tomato plants. Lobelia inflata, commonly known as Indian tobacco, has a long history of traditional medicinal uses as well.

To propagate Lobelia inflata, you can use either cuttings or seeds. If you choose to use seeds, they can be sown in containers in mid-spring or mid-fall. The seeds typically take about two weeks to germinate.

It's important to note that while Lobelia inflata has traditional medicinal uses, consuming it can cause adverse effects. Some of these effects may include sweating, nausea, vomiting, diarrhea, tremors, rapid heartbeat, mental confusion, convulsions, hypothermia, coma, or even death. The roots of the plant are toxic and should not be eaten.
